  • Patent number: 9694668
    Abstract: A cooling module is formed by stacking a condenser mounted in order to cool an engine of a vehicle and cool a refrigerant of an air conditioner, an electronic radiator disposed below the condenser, an engine radiator, and a fan shroud assembly and capable of improving cooling performance of the electronic radiator by forming the engine radiator in only a region in which the condenser is formed or forming the engine radiator in a portion of a region in which the electronic radiator is formed as well as the region in which the condenser is formed, in a height direction and including an air guide installed at a portion corresponding to the electronic radiator below the engine radiator to allow air to be introduced toward the electronic radiator.

  • Patent number: 9261013
    Abstract: The present invention relates to a reservoir tank for an automobile, which is provided with a height-adjustable sub filler neck so as to be retracted when not in use and extracted when filling coolant, whereby the reservoir tank can be disposed low in the automobile. The reservoir tank forming a cooling module together with a condenser, a radiator and a fan and shroud assembly is disposed at a carrier, and includes a filler neck for filling coolant and a cap for closing the filler neck, and is communicated with a radiator so as to control an amount of the coolant in the radiator, wherein the reservoir tank is integrally formed with a shroud of the fan and the shroud assembly, and the filler neck is formed with a sub filler neck which is retracted into and extracted from the filler neck.
